Linux OS Update

I have been installing Linux OS distributions all day. I am working with a 20GB drive that a friend gave me. I have had to reinstall a few times as the footprint of the different OSs where larger than I thought.

Initially, I gave each OS 6GB with 512MB for swap space. Ubuntu only took up about 2.5GB and BackTrack 2 took about 3GB. Unfortunately, Sabayon takes about 12GB for all the options I selected. After a few tries I think I finally have the partitions right - the changes even allow for a larger swap space. Hopefully the install will work this time.
